To understand the significance of the 1.0 version, one must first contextualize the hardware of the time. When Outfit7 released the original Talking Tom Cat in 2010, the concept of a "smartphone" was still fresh. The App Store and the Android Market (now Google Play) were burgeoning ecosystems filled with novelty apps. Users were enamored not by high-fidelity graphics, but by the sheer novelty of touchscreen interactivity. The 1.0 APK (Android Package Kit) represents the raw, unadulterated code that first captivated a global audience.

At its core, the mechanics of Talking Tom Cat 1.0 were deceptively simple. The application featured a gray tabby cat named Tom who stood in a solitary alleyway backdrop. The interaction loop was minimalistic: Tom would repeat everything the user said in a high-pitched, helium-toned voice. Users could poke, pet, or grab the cat, triggering rudimentary animations—a slap would knock Tom over, a belly rub would elicit a purr, and a foot stomp would cause him to hiss. This simplicity, however, was the key to its viral success. It required no tutorial, no language skills, and offered immediate gratification.

From a technical perspective, the 1.0 APK is an artifact of early mobile development. By modern standards, the graphics were basic; Tom’s model was somewhat stiff, and the textures were low-resolution. The file size was minuscule compared to modern gaming apps, meaning it could be downloaded quickly even on the 3G networks prevalent at the time. This lightweight nature ensured that the app was accessible to a wide range of devices, from flagship phones to budget entry-level handsets. It demonstrated that an app did not need console-quality graphics to engage users; it only needed a responsive interface and a spark of personality.

The legacy of the version 1.0 lies in its establishment of the "virtual pet" genre on mobile platforms. While digital pets like Tamagotchi had existed for decades, Talking Tom Cat utilized the smartphone's microphone, speaker, and touchscreen to create an illusion of companionship that felt revolutionary. It bridged the gap between a toy and a tool. For many users, particularly children, the 1.0 version was their first experience with voice-modulation technology and interactive animation.

The Legacy of Talking Tom Cat 1.0 APK: A Digital Revolution Released internationally on June 26, 2010, the original Talking Tom Cat 1.0 was more than just a mobile application; it was the spark that ignited the global Talking Tom & Friends franchise. Developed by Outfit7, this simple interaction-based app turned a virtual alley cat into a multimedia sensation, reaching one million downloads within just 13 days of its launch.

Today, users still seek out the Talking Tom Cat 1.0 APK to relive the nostalgic, unpolished charm of the original "talking" pet that started it all. Key Features of the Original 1.0 Version

The 1.0 release was celebrated for its simplicity, focusing on direct interaction rather than the complex mini-games and progression systems found in modern sequels like My Talking Tom.

Voice Mimicry: Tom's flagship feature was his ability to repeat anything the user said into the microphone in a high-pitched, helium-like voice. Physical Interactions:

Petting: Stroke Tom's belly to make him purr with happiness.

Poking: Tap his head until he "sees stars" or pokes his feet to hear sounds of pain.

Tail Pulling: Grabbing or pulling his tail would make him visibly angry. Unique Actions:

Milk Button: A dedicated button (which was a simple still image in the very first iOS version) allowed users to pour a glass of milk for Tom to drink.

Humor: The original version included quirky animations like Tom farting, throwing a pie at the screen, or scratching marks on the glass.

Video Sharing: Even in 1.0, users could record 30-second clips of their interactions and upload them to YouTube or Facebook. Technical Evolution and Relaunches
